Transaction 52c19e48966f79c8107859862fcd44fca05ee25207ace97e96e7893ac4a441e9
1 Input
2 Outputs
- 52c19e48966f79c8107859862fcd44fca05ee25207ace97e96e7893ac4a441e9:0
- 52c19e48966f79c8107859862fcd44fca05ee25207ace97e96e7893ac4a441e9:1
value 693718
address 14HwuT6HGMTypthiPbCQHxTuTBAXXPtCsA
value 16207000
address 3L9WVL3rgyc1MjQ29nEaq6MKijtjYfX5fg